Declare your fitness intentions
Worried about sticking to your regimen this season? Make sure your family and friends know about your goals ahead of time so they can help you work toward them. People will be much more likely to encourage you if you make it clear how important your fitness is to you. You can even make this favor a “gift” request! Today, challenge yourself to tell your holiday guests or relatives that you intend to keep on track with your fitness goals. Let them know if there’s a way they can help you achieve them.
